2. Key Differences Analysis

Samsung Galaxy S23 Ultra Advantages:

  • Significantly more powerful: The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 provides a substantial performance advantage for demanding tasks and gaming.
  • Sharper display: Higher resolution offers greater clarity and detail.
  • Superior camera system: Higher resolution main sensor, dedicated telephoto lenses for optical zoom, and 8K video recording.

Xiaomi Poco X6 Advantages:

  • Lighter and Potentially More Affordable: Offers a more comfortable in-hand feel and potentially a lower price point depending on the specific configuration.
  • Faster Charging: 67W fast charging significantly reduces charging time compared to the S23 Ultra's 45W.
  • Slightly Larger Battery: Potentially longer battery life, though real-world usage varies.

3. User Profiles & Recommendations

Samsung Galaxy S23 Ultra: Users who prioritize performance, camera quality, and a premium display experience. Ideal for power users, mobile gamers, content creators, and photography enthusiasts.

Xiaomi Poco X6: Users seeking a more affordable option with a lightweight design, fast charging, and a good display. Suitable for everyday users, social media enthusiasts, and those who prioritize value for money.
